Output e3edc5f11523631d2867eb30d1ae2d94785067f8779cf9800681c11f96bbfaf2:33

value
93586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d97a71be85c5eac9051cdd087873df1174c443b OP_EQUAL
address
3D964YNaU5jQiNoHk5sRoDwxfvY7DysS92
transaction
e3edc5f11523631d2867eb30d1ae2d94785067f8779cf9800681c11f96bbfaf2
confirmations
252275
spent
true